RFmxLteMXComponentCarrierGetDownlinkUserDefinedCellSpecificRatio Method
Gets the ratio Rhob/Rhoa for the cell-specific ratio of one, two, or four cell-specific antenna ports as described in Table 5.2-1 in section 5.2 of the 3GPP TS 36.213 specification. This method determines the power of the channel resource element (RE) in the symbols that do not contain the reference symbols.

Syntax
public int GetDownlinkUserDefinedCellSpecificRatio( string selectorString, out RFmxLteMXDownlinkUserDefinedRatio value )
Public Function GetDownlinkUserDefinedCellSpecificRatio ( selectorString As String, <OutAttribute> ByRef value As RFmxLteMXDownlinkUserDefinedRatio ) As Integer
Parameters
- selectorString
- Type: SystemString
Specifies the carrier number and subblock number.
Example:
"subblock0" or
"subblock0/carrier0".
You can use the BuildCarrierString(String, Int32) method to build the selector string. - value
- Type: NationalInstruments.RFmx.LteMXRFmxLteMXDownlinkUserDefinedRatio
Upon return, contains the ratio Rhob/Rhoa for the cell-specific ratio of one, two, or four cell-specific antenna ports as described in Table 5.2-1 in section 5.2 of the 3GPP TS 36.213 specification. This method determines the power of the channel resource element (RE) in the symbols that do not contain the reference symbols.
Return Value
Type: Int32Returns the status code of this method. The status code either indicates success or describes a warning condition.
Remarks
This method gets the value of DownlinkUserDefinedCellSpecificRatio attribute. The default value is P_B=0.
